Whether you’re a seasoned Excel user or a novice, encountering the dreaded “Clipboard error” can be a frustrating experience. This error message, “There’s a problem with the clipboard, but you can still paste your content within this workbook”, restricts your ability to copy or cut data across different workbooks or applications, hindering your workflow.
In this Excel tutorial, I will show you how to create a VCARD (VCF) file using VBA. A VCARD file is a standard format for storing contact information, such as name, phone number, email address, etc. You can use a VCARD file to share your contacts with other applications or devices, such as Outlook, Gmail, or smartphones.

Variance is a measure of how spread out the values are in a dataset. It is calculated by averaging the squared deviations from the mean. A higher variance indicates greater variability among the values, while a lower variance indicates less variability.

ODS files are spreadsheet files created by OpenOffice.org Calc. Excel does not natively support ODS files, but there are a few ways to open them.
Employee incentives, also known as rewards or motivation, are bonuses or payments that employers give to employees in addition to their regular salary. These bonuses are used to motivate employees to do their best and achieve specific goals. Incentives can take many different forms, such as cash bonuses, gift certificates, extra vacation days, or even company stock.
